The Evolution of commercial IT services
Commercial IT services have come a long way since their inception. In the early days of IT outsourcing, businesses would hire external providers to manage their networks and troubleshoot technical issues. However, with the rapid advancement of technology, the scope of commercial IT services has expanded significantly. Today, commercial IT service providers offer a wide range of services, including cloud computing, cybersecurity, data analytics, and more.
One of the key drivers of this evolution is the growing complexity of IT infrastructures. As businesses expand and adopt new technologies, the demand for specialized IT expertise has increased. Commercial IT service providers have responded to this demand by expanding their service offerings to include a broader range of services. This evolution has enabled businesses to access the expertise they need to stay competitive in today’s digital economy.
How Businesses Benefit from Outsourcing IT Services
Outsourcing IT services to commercial providers offers several benefits for businesses of all sizes. One of the primary advantages is cost savings. By outsourcing their IT needs, businesses can avoid the expense of hiring and training an in-house IT team. Commercial IT service providers have the expertise and resources to manage IT infrastructure more efficiently, resulting in lower costs for businesses.
Another key benefit of outsourcing IT services is scalability. Commercial IT service providers offer flexible pricing models that allow businesses to pay only for the services they need. This scalability is particularly valuable for small and medium-sized businesses that may not have the resources to invest in a full-time IT team. By outsourcing IT services, businesses can easily scale up or down as their needs change.
In addition to cost savings and scalability, outsourcing IT services can also help businesses stay ahead of the curve when it comes to technology. Commercial IT service providers invest heavily in training and certifications to ensure their staff has the latest skills and expertise. By outsourcing their IT needs, businesses can access this knowledge without the expense of hiring and training an in-house team.
Finally, outsourcing IT services can improve the overall efficiency and effectiveness of business operations. Commercial IT service providers have the resources and expertise to identify and resolve technical issues quickly, minimizing downtime and improving productivity. By outsourcing their IT needs, businesses can focus on their core competencies and leave the technical details to the experts.
